- In today's video, we'll take a look at the Canon EOS R and try to figure out if it's still a camera worth buying. There are so many cameras out there and they're all pretty good now. They all share similar specs but they tend to vary in price. If you want a relatively cheap but semi-pro camera that can do slow-motion and shoot in 4k, look no further than the Canon R. It's a sturdy amazing mirrorless full-frame sensor camera that's perfect for your all-around video, photo needs.
